How much does it cost to rent an apartment in 75707?
| Bedroom | Average Rent | Cheapest Rent | Highest Rent |
|---|---|---|---|
| 75707 Studio Apartments | $841 | $727 | $1,239 |
| 75707 1 Bedroom Apartments | $1,157 | $536 | $4,002 |
| 75707 2 Bedroom Apartments | $1,183 | $784 | $3,797 |
| 75707 3 Bedroom Apartments | $1,600 | $1,185 | $6,803 |
